Output 07e3e394956c159fd2024bc7e1b1eb329a39e404e9e1f092f8794f29430143da:1

value
2623306
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a8ee787e51eb49ffa79f52fda59beb62cffe579 OP_EQUALVERIFY OP_CHECKSIG
address
13RRmAKBhNj5UF74jY48gragjSZX1CLoAJ
transaction
07e3e394956c159fd2024bc7e1b1eb329a39e404e9e1f092f8794f29430143da
spent
true